Abstract
Dental implant supported restoration is one of the successful treatment option to restore totally or partially edentulous arches. After implant placement a traditional loading period of 3 to 6 months is recommended for implant restoration. Immediate loading of implant is one of the ways of eliminating the traditional healing period. immediate provisionalization of an implant is needed for the patient to provide tooth like structure to satisfy the patient desire to replace missing tooth. Various techniques have been described in the literature for a successful fabrication of a provisional restoration at the time of implant placement. Indexing an implant at the time of surgery can facilitate the placement of a provisional restoration earlier in the healing period or after implant in the healing period or after implant exposure. This article describes a method of fabricating cement retained provisional restoration immediately after implant placement.
